Driveway Sealcoating in Fort Collins, CO
Driveway sealcoating is a protective service that involves applying a specialized coating to asphalt surfaces to help extend their lifespan and maintain their appearance. This process is commonly requested for residential driveways, parking areas, and other paved surfaces around homes. It provides a barrier against water, oils, and other substances that can cause deterioration over time, helping to prevent cracks, potholes, and surface wear. Homeowners typically seek sealcoating to preserve the integrity of their driveway, improve curb appeal, and reduce long-term repair costs.
Before requesting driveway sealcoating, property owners often want to understand the current condition of their asphalt surface and whether any repairs are needed beforehand. Proper surface preparation, such as cleaning and fixing existing cracks, can be essential for optimal results. Additionally, homeowners may inquire about the best timing for application, weather considerations, and the expected lifespan of the coating. Clear information about these factors can help ensure the sealcoating process effectively protects the driveway and meets long-term maintenance goals.

Driveway Sealcoating Questions
What is driveway sealcoating? Driveway sealcoating involves applying a protective layer to asphalt surfaces to help prevent damage from weather, oils, and UV rays.
How often should driveway sealcoating be done? Sealcoating is typically recommended every 2 to 3 years to maintain surface protection and appearance.
What types of driveways can benefit from sealcoating? Asphalt driveways, whether residential or commercial, commonly benefit from sealcoating to extend their lifespan.
What are common signs that a driveway needs sealcoating? Cracks, fading color, and surface wear are signs that a driveway may need a fresh sealcoat.
